private static MqttDecoder.Result<MqttConnAckVariableHeader> |
MqttDecoder.decodeConnAckVariableHeader(ChannelContext ctx,
ByteBuffer buffer) |
private static MqttDecoder.Result<MqttConnectPayload> |
MqttDecoder.decodeConnectionPayload(ByteBuffer buffer,
int maxClientIdLength,
MqttConnectVariableHeader mqttConnectVariableHeader) |
private static MqttDecoder.Result<MqttConnectVariableHeader> |
MqttDecoder.decodeConnectionVariableHeader(ChannelContext ctx,
ByteBuffer buffer) |
private static MqttDecoder.Result<MqttMessageIdAndPropertiesVariableHeader> |
MqttDecoder.decodeMessageIdAndPropertiesVariableHeader(ChannelContext ctx,
ByteBuffer buffer,
MqttFixedHeader mqttFixedHeader) |
private static MqttDecoder.Result<?> |
MqttDecoder.decodePayload(ByteBuffer buffer,
int maxClientIdLength,
MqttMessageType messageType,
int bytesRemainingInVariablePart,
Object variableHeader)
Decodes the payload.
|
private static MqttDecoder.Result<MqttProperties> |
MqttDecoder.decodeProperties(ByteBuffer buffer) |
private static MqttDecoder.Result<ByteBuffer> |
MqttDecoder.decodePublishPayload(ByteBuffer buffer,
int bytesRemainingInVariablePart) |
private MqttDecoder.Result<MqttPublishVariableHeader> |
MqttDecoder.decodePublishVariableHeader(ChannelContext ctx,
ByteBuffer buffer,
MqttFixedHeader mqttFixedHeader) |
private MqttDecoder.Result<MqttPubReplyMessageVariableHeader> |
MqttDecoder.decodePubReplyMessage(ByteBuffer buffer,
MqttFixedHeader mqttFixedHeader,
int bytesRemainingInVariablePart) |
private MqttDecoder.Result<MqttReasonCodeAndPropertiesVariableHeader> |
MqttDecoder.decodeReasonCodeAndPropertiesVariableHeader(ByteBuffer buffer,
int bytesRemainingInVariablePart) |
private static MqttDecoder.Result<String> |
MqttDecoder.decodeString(ByteBuffer buffer) |
private static MqttDecoder.Result<String> |
MqttDecoder.decodeString(ByteBuffer buffer,
int minBytes,
int maxBytes) |
private static MqttDecoder.Result<MqttSubAckPayload> |
MqttDecoder.decodeSubAckPayload(ByteBuffer buffer,
int bytesRemainingInVariablePart) |
private static MqttDecoder.Result<MqttSubscribePayload> |
MqttDecoder.decodeSubscribePayload(ByteBuffer buffer,
int bytesRemainingInVariablePart) |
private static MqttDecoder.Result<MqttUnsubAckPayload> |
MqttDecoder.decodeUnsubAckPayload(ByteBuffer buffer,
int bytesRemainingInVariablePart) |
private static MqttDecoder.Result<MqttUnsubscribePayload> |
MqttDecoder.decodeUnsubscribePayload(ByteBuffer buffer,
int bytesRemainingInVariablePart) |
private MqttDecoder.Result<?> |
MqttDecoder.decodeVariableHeader(ChannelContext ctx,
ByteBuffer buffer,
MqttFixedHeader mqttFixedHeader,
int bytesRemainingInVariablePart)
Decodes the variable header (if any)
|